Well, I'm pretty confident that it won’t happen in our lifetimes at least. Unless you can think of some mechanism occurring again which creates a bell curve of age distribution to create a wave of mass retirements between all the big airlines at the same time. And right when that starts, introduce a black swan event where you offer a lot of early outs reducing pilot staffing even more. Then have the recovery from said black swan event occur faster than anybody in their wildest dreams could have imagined in the midst of the mass retirements. All of this combined creating the greatest ~2.5 years of airline hiring the planet has ever seen.


Yeah, I am pretty confident we won’t see those 2.5 years level of hiring ever again.
